Get ready to crank up the volume and keep the summer vibes alive because the Red Hot Summer Tour is back and it’s hotter than ever. The festival is hitting the road again, bringing the best of live music to regional Australia, and the Hunter Valley is on the map.

The lineup is bound to get you moving and singing along, featuring plenty of Aussie music icons.

With Jimmy Barnes, The Living End, Birds of Tokyo, Pete Murray, Kasey Chambers, and Mahalia Barnes and the Soulmates taking to the stage, you know you're in for a treat.

red hot summer tour hunter valley

After a slight delay due to Jimmy Barnes needing some time to mend after open heart surgery earlier this year, the tour is hitting Roche Estate in Pokolbin this April. This open-air venue ensures that every seat is the best seat in the house, so don't forget to bring your camp chair and settle in for an epic day of music outdoors.

There’ll be a wide range of food and drink options available on the day, so you'll be spoilt for choice to keep you fuelled while you enjoy the festival.
